WE RHYME FOR A REASON

The human brain thrives on patterns. Research shows that rhyming material is more easily recognized, processed, and remembered than non-rhyming content, even when the meaning is identical. For young children, exposure to rhymed text improves long-term retention, supports vocabulary development, strengthens phonological awareness, and enhances memory for sequences. Rhymes provide predictable sound patterns that guide attention, create anticipation, and reinforce learning pathways, making scientific concepts more accessible and memorable.

 

When scientific ideas are delivered through rhythmic prose, the brain encodes them in multiple ways: as narrative and as pattern. This dual encoding acts as mnemonic reinforcement, strengthening recall and helping children retain complex concepts in physics, biology, and other sciences. By combining rhythm, story, and science, we make learning both memorable and aligned with how the brain naturally processes information. We rhyme for a reason: to increase learning and fun.

THE IMPORTANCE OF INTEGRATING SEL AND LANGUAGE ARTS WITH STEM

Preparing the next generation extends far beyond academic performance. Children are not only learning facts. They are learning how to think, connect, and engage with the world. Integrating Social Emotional Learning (SEL) and Language Arts with STEM equips children to become confident, compassionate, and capable human beings. Research demonstrates that social-emotional skills such as empathy, self-regulation, and collaboration support cognitive development, problem-solving, and long-term academic success. Children who develop these skills are better able to manage frustration, persist through challenges, and engage deeply with complex material.

Through Language Arts, children learn to interpret discoveries, organize their thinking, and communicate ideas clearly. SEL teaches them to recognize and manage emotions, understand perspectives, and form positive relationships. When children work together on a science project, they practice far more than scientific reasoning. They navigate disagreements, encourage peers, share credit for success, and take responsibility for mistakes. These experiences strengthen executive function, enhance metacognition, and build social resilience.

 

Exploring science, technology, engineering, and mathematics in an integrated, collaborative environment prepares children for life in more than one way.  They are developing curiosity, critical thinking, and the capacity to solve problems thoughtfully. By engaging both mind and heart, this approach nurtures a generation capable of innovation, ethical decision-making, and lifelong learning.
